@charset "utf-8"; /* CSS Document */ 
*	{margin:0; padding:0}
a img, fieldset	{border:none}
a em {
display:none;}
a, a:active	{color: #FFFFFF; text-decoration:none}
a:hover	{color:#FFFF00;}
body	{color: #FFFFFF; padding:0; margin:0; font-family:"Trebuchet MS", Helvetica, Arial, sans-serif; font-size:14px;text-align:left; background:#000000 url(../images/bg_home.jpg) repeat-x 0 0 }
#mount{ position:absolute; z-index:0; margin:0; width:100% !important; height:636px; text-align:left; background:url(../images/mount.jpg) no-repeat fixed}

.footer {font-size:11px; position:absolute; color:#333333;top:636px;}
#bottomnote{ margin-left:15px; }
#bottomnote2{ margin-left:580px; }
.clear { clear:both;}
.texthomepage{ height:20px;width:100px;position:absolute; left:580px; top:410px; width:294px; color:#000000; font-size:11px; line-height:17px; background:url(../images/news.png) no-repeat 0 0 }
.texthomepage p{ margin-top:20px;}
#logohomepage{ width:318px; height:166px; background: url(../images/logo_mihogaseki.jpg) no-repeat; float:left; margin-left:206px; margin-top:120px}
#menuhomepage{ margin-top:230px; margin-left:45px; height:140px; float:left}
#menuhomepage a{ float:left; display:block; width:27px; height:154px; margin-left:9px; background-position:0 -10px}
#menuhomepage a:hover{ background-position:0 -180px}
a#b01{ background:url(../images/b01.png) no-repeat}
a#b02{background:url(../images/b02.png) no-repeat}
a#b03{background:url(../images/b03.png) no-repeat}
a#b04{background:url(../images/b04.png) no-repeat}
a#b05{background:url(../images/b05.png) no-repeat}
a#b06{background:url(../images/b06.png) no-repeat}
a#b07{background:url(../images/b07.png) no-repeat}
a#bsnapshots{background:url(../images/bsnapshots.png) no-repeat}
a#biwai{background:url(../images/biwai.png) no-repeat}
#news {position:absolute; z-index:1;left:580px; font-size:12px; top:440px;color:black;}